Approximating formulae

S. V. Sudoplatov

Sobolev Institute of Mathematics, Academician Koptyug avenue, 4 630090, Novosibirsk, Russia

Abstract: The notion of a approximating formula is introduced. Links of approximating formulae and their spectra for pseudofiniteness are studied. Semilattices, lattices, and Boolean algebras related to approximating formulae are found. Rank values of approximating formulae are studied. Relations between approximating formulae and positive, negative, $\forall$-formulae, $\exists$-formulae, $\exists\forall$-formulae, $\forall\exists$-formulae are considered. Families of consistent formulae are considered and their approximability is characterized. The notion of totally approximating sentence is introduced and families of these sentences are characterized in terms of cardinalities of models and cardinalities of signatures.
